[1] Registered on 25 March 1997,[2] the party joined the For a Democratic and Prosperous Moldova alliance to contest the 1998 elections.
[3] The alliance received 18% of the vote, winning 24 of the 101 seats and becoming the third-largest faction in Parliament.
It formed the Alliance for Democracy and Reforms coalition together with Democratic Convention of Moldova and the Party of Democratic Forces, which was able to form a government led by Ion Ciubuc.
[2] The alliance was dissolved prior to the 2001 elections,[3] which the PDPM did not contest.
It joined the Our Moldova Alliance for the May 2003 local elections,[2] before merging into it in July 2003.
